Here Are Key Terms You Must Know in 2025:
General Terms (All Property Types):
- Freehold: Full ownership without time limits.
- Leasehold: Ownership for a specific term (e.g., 99 years).
- Escrow Account: Safeguards buyer funds until contract conditions are met.
- ROI: Return on Investment.
- Yield: Rental income as a percentage of property value.
- Capital Appreciation: Increase in value over time.
- Title Deed: Official ownership document.
- SPA (Sales Purchase Agreement): Legally binding sale contract.
- Valuation Report: Independent assessment of a property’s market value.
- DLD / ADREC Fees: Government fees (DLD for Dubai, ADREC for Abu Dhabi).
- Ejari / Tawtheeq: Rental contract registration platforms.

Residential Real Estate Terms:
- Built-up Area (BUA): Total area including balconies and walls.
- Net Area / Carpet Area: Usable space inside the unit.
- Service Charges: Maintenance of shared areas.
- Mortgage Pre-Approval: Early bank confirmation of loan eligibility.
- Community Fees: Regular charges by developers for amenities.
- Snagging: Defect-check process before handover.
- Handover Date: Official property possession date.
- Oqood: Registration for off-plan property transactions.
Commercial Real Estate Terms:
- FAR (Floor Area Ratio): Buildable area vs land area.
- GLA (Gross Leasable Area): Rentable space for tenants.
- Anchor Tenant: Major brand or tenant that drives traffic.
- CAM Charges: Common area maintenance fees.
- Shell & Core: Unfurnished commercial units.
- Fit-Out: Interior setup for operational use.
- Triple Net Lease (NNN): Lease where tenant covers rent + expenses.
Industrial Real Estate Terms:
- Zoning Classification: Permitted land use as per government regulations.
- Warehousing Space: Buildings used for storage/distribution.
- Power Capacity: Available electricity supply.
- Industrial Lease Terms: Conditions, safety rules, permitted use.
- Cold Storage Facility: Temperature-controlled storage.
- Loading Dock / Bay: Designated loading/unloading areas.
- Logistics Hub: Key node for transport and supply chain services.
